Indian Budget 2026 Backs Gaming Talent Push With 15,000 School Labs

India will set up animation and gaming labs in 15,000 schools and 500 colleges to address a looming talent gap in its creative technology sector,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man announced on Sunday. The budget did not specify the total allocation for the program or implementation timeline.

The initiative, part of the Union Budget 2026-27, will be executed through the Indian Institute of Creative Technologies in Mumbai. The government projects India will need 2 million professionals in animation, visual effects, gaming and comics by 2030.

"The government's backing of IICT reflects a clear commitment to equipping young Indians with future-ready skills," said Akshat Rathee, co-founder of NODWIN Gaming, which specializes in youth culture, esports, and gaming, particularly in emerging markets. The company requires skilled talent for immersive experiences and sees the labs expanding the talent pool.

Animesh Agarwal, founder of S8UL Esports, said the 2 million target "highlights both the scale of the opportunity and the responsibility on industry and institutions to prepare future-ready talent."

Hardware makers see demand rising for high-performance computing in schools. "Realizing this vision calls for access to computing environments that match global benchmarks," said Vishal Parekh, chief operating officer of CyberPowerPC India.

Sagar Nair, who runs the LVL Zero incubator for gaming startups, said success depends on connecting education to entrepreneurship. "When skilling is paired with incubation and clear pathways to entrepreneurship, India can cultivate a generation of creators equipped to build original intellectual property," he said.

Nitish Mittersain, joint managing director of Nazara Technologies, said the budget's focus is "a very positive step" that could help India build original intellectual property and become a global hub for gaming. "This is not just about employment—it's about creating original Indian IP," he said.

Video Game Stocks Tumble After Google Unveils AI Game Generator

Major video game stocks fell sharply after Google unveiled Project Genie, an AI tool that generates interactive game-like experiences from text prompts. Take-Two dropped 7.9%, Roblox declined 13.2%, and Unity plunged 24.2%. The tool, trained on 200,000+ hours of online gaming videos, produces 60-second playable worlds but has sparked concerns about AI replacing development work amid ongoing industry layoffs.

GameStop CEO Eyes Major Acquisition to Hit $100 Billion Target

GameStop CEO Ryan Cohen said he wants to acquire a large publicly traded company in consumer or retail, according to the Wall Street Journal. Cohen must grow GameStop's market cap from $10.68 billion to $100 billion to unlock a $35 billion compensation package. The retailer has $9 billion in cash for acquisitions. GameStop shares rose 3.5% following his comments.

Austrian Court Rules FIFA Loot Boxes Don't Constitute Gambling

Austria's Supreme Court ruled that FIFA Ultimate Team loot boxes are not gambling because players can use skill to control game outcomes. The decision dismissed claims from gamers who spent €20,000 combined on loot boxes. Electronic Arts welcomed the ruling. Litigation funder Padronus called the judgment "legally flawed" and has other cases pending against EA and Sony.

Indie Climbing Game 'Cairn' Sells 200,000 Copies in Three Days

Indie climbing game "Cairn" sold 200,000 copies in its first three days, with Steam concurrent users rising daily since launch. The game has a 94% positive user rating, marking the first breakout Indie video game success of 2026. By comparison, Don't Nod's climbing game "Jusant" peaked at 349 concurrent players on Steam.

WWE 2K26 Drops Last-Gen Consoles, Adds Battle Pass System

WWE 2K26 will release March 13 on P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X/S, Switch 2 and PC, ending support for PlayStation 4 and Xbox One after a decade. The game features over 400 playable wrestlers and replaces downloadable content packs with a Ringside Pass system offering six seasons of unlockable content.

📚 Read: Megan Condis and Jess Morrissette analyzed 2,875 print ads from the 1990s console wars to test the legend: Nintendo for families, Sega for edgy teens. The data reveals both companies targeted males overwhelmingly, Nintendo had nearly as much sexual content as Sega, and only the family-focused messaging matched the myth. A systematic look at how gaming's "boys club" culture was advertised into existence.

YouTuber Markiplier's self-distributed horror film Iron Lung earned $21.5 million globally in its opening weekend, seven times its $3 million production budget. The film, based on a 2022 indie submarine horror game, pulled $17.8 million domestically and topped the box office charts before briefly disappearing from tracking site The Numbers. Markiplier, who has 38.2 million YouTube subscribers, previously played the game on his channel in popular Let's Play videos.
